Garrison Joe, SASS #60708 Posted May 12, 2021 Share Posted May 12, 2021 That would be laser checkering, which is quick enough to do at events. Hand cut checkering is finer quality and a little more durable, but much more expensive and fewer practitioners. Tazz does laser checkering, mainly around Arizona and New England.
